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
25 44970 10016837 78 329
409659 397110
409659 397110
857 8597 02658421
All about undefined
Interested in learning more?
409659 397110
857 8597 02658421
See more
87095985714 65683706027
20629 5277268696 161
See more
0697868 414463749 975253
4834242 62902 757079 31013941539 994
See more